NSU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2015 in Review

92 of the 3,754 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Nevsun Resources Ltd. (NSU) for Q1 2015, worth a combined $198M — down 12% from $224M a quarter earlier.

Fund positioning in NSU was balanced in Q1 2015: 13 funds opened new positions, 13 closed out, 31 added to existing stakes and 36 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Vanguard Group, opening a new position worth an estimated $6.49M. The largest seller was Franklin Resources, cutting an estimated $3.64M.
